Scientific Impact of Conventional and Novel Cigarette Products on Dentistry: A Bibliometric Mapping of Publications

Abstract

Purpose: This study aims to analyze the global trends of scientific publications examining the impact of conventional and novel cigarette products on dental materials using bibliometric methods.
Materials & Methods: This bibliometric study investigates works conducted between 2010 and 2025 that examine the impact of cigarette products on dental materials worldwide. For this purpose, a search in the Web of Science (WOS) database was conducted using the keywords (“cigarette” OR “smoking” OR “e-cigarette” OR “electronic cigarette” OR “heated tobacco products”) AND (“dental material” OR “dental tissue” OR "enamel” OR “dentin” OR “resin composite” OR “dental composite” OR “dental porcelain”). All text data were analyzed using VOSviewer (ver 1.6.20) software to ensure accuracy and reliability.
Results: Information has been provided about the 273 articles obtained from the WOS database and the 9,606 citations these articles received. The average number of citations per article is 35, and the H-index is 49. Since 2010, both the number of articles and citations have increased. As a result of the keyword analysis, the most frequently used and interconnected conceptual clusters in the literature include terms such as “periodontitis”, “guided tissue regeneration,” and “gingival recession.” The United States, Brazil, and Italy are the leading countries publishing the most articles on this topic, contributing to approximately 50% of the total. Most of the articles (86%) are categorized in the SCI-Expanded category.
Conclusion: Studies investigating the effects of cigarettes on dental-periodontal tissues and dental materials are predominantly scientifically impactful and reliable publications. Research on this topic is increasingly gaining popularity and attracting attention.
Keywords: Cigarettes, Dental materials, Dental tissues, Electronic cigarettes, Periodontitis
